Filmmaker Eliran Eliya Joins Gadi Eisenkot's 'Yashar' Party
Director and screenwriter Eliran Eliya, known for the acclaimed film "Motel Besfek" (Doubting) and the series "Ha'ir Ha'tova" (The Good City), has joined the "Yashar" party led by Gadi Eisenkot. Eliya, who currently chairs the Directors Guild of Israel, has a history of blending his work in film and television with educational and public service activities. His creative projects have often explored themes of at-risk youth, education, and social disparities.
Eliya also has experience in local politics, having served as Deputy Mayor of Or Yehuda and responsible for informal education and development in older neighborhoods. During his tenure, he advocated for the rights of the LGBTQ+ community in the city. He currently remains a member of the Or Yehuda city council.
Within the "Yashar" party, Eliya is expected to focus on education and culture, reducing societal gaps, strengthening local governance, and promoting Israeli arts and culture. His involvement signals the party's effort to broaden its appeal by incorporating figures from the cultural and public spheres.
